Chair; Cherrie Dubois; Vicki Yablonsky ; OW,t� jl <br />Library, Director; Paula Perry, Finance Committee Liaison. ,1011 SAN 1 U <br />Absent: <br />Jeffrey Doucette; Karyn Storti. <br />Meeting called to order: 7:05 p.m. <br />FY13 Action Plan Update <br />Rough draft handed out and preliminary discussion of updates for the FY2012 AND FY2013 Plan of <br />Service. Library staff meetings to plan activities are ongoing. <br />Creating New Ways to Connect & Explore - Goals: <br />• Be a gathering place for the community <br />• Connect across generations <br />• Create new messages to connect new audiences <br />Creating New Ways to Engage & Inspire — Goals: <br />• Customize and personalize service /convenience and value <br />• Inspire future generations and remember the past <br />• Inspire all ages with programs <br />Creating New Ways to Grow and Learn — Goals: <br />• Create young readers: early literacy <br />• Grown young readers and support independent readers <br />• Be a lifelong learning center. <br />R. Urell will present the final Action Plan Update to Trustees for approval at the next meeting held on <br />Monday, December 19, 2011. <br />Budget FY13 <br />Salaries - implement step increase — no COLA. <br />Expenses — -equipment and tech costs soaring -need to upgrade both public and staff technology <br />-substantial increase in Noble software that is beyond 2% increase will come from Accommodated <br />Costs per Finance Director and Town Manager. <br />Materials — book budget will be 15 %, in compliance with state aid requirement. <br />R. Urell will work on draft budget details to provide a clearer sense of the expenses and submit it next <br />week to Finance Director. <br />Adjourn <br />The motion to adjourn was made 8:25 p.m. (D.
